Epidemic
The rapid spread of an infectious disease to a large number of people within a short period of time, geographically localized.
Computed Tomography (CT)
A medical imaging technique that uses computer-processed combinations of many X-ray measurements taken from different angles to create cross-sectional images of the body.
N-95 Respirator Mask
A respiratory protective device designed to achieve a very close facial fit and very efficient filtration of airborne particles, known for its capability to filter out at least 95% of airborne particulates.
Wound Culture
A diagnostic test involving the collection and cultivation of tissue, fluid, or discharge from a wound to identify the presence of pathogens.
